3.0 out of 5 stars Useful, but a little disappointing, May 29, 2007
This review is from: Pocket Grammar (Pocket Dictionary) (Paperback)
I have to agree with a previous reviewer who described this book as bloated. Although I don't have any problems with the organization (the presentation of essere and avere is a bit scattered, but still logical), this book is 150 pages longer than my Langenscheidt's Pocket Spanish Grammar, which I love, mostly due to unwanted advice on form letters. The best features of the series are the handy size, along with the vinyl cover and the strong binding, which make the books good traveling companions. This one, however, is in need of serious editing. Still, it's OK for a basic grammar reference.

5.0 out of 5 stars Used to be Cassell's, February 2, 2003

This used to be part of Cassell's Contemporary Italian/French/Spanish/German series, which are now out of print. I have them all the they are the best grammar books I own. I am a language buff and own several grammars and these are the best! I had been looking for the Cassell's Contemporary Italian recently and discovered the Langenscheidt Pocket Grammars are the Cassell's Contemporary series in new editions.

1.0 out of 5 stars Badly organized and incomplete, April 16, 2004

This grammar book is a big disappointment. I bought it because of my positive experience with other Langenscheidt's foreign language texts. But this bloated and disorganized text should be avoided. Astonishingly enough, the conjugations for "avere" and "essere" are not included in the appendix of irregular verbs. You have to look them up by tense and mood as they appear piecemeal elsewhere in the book! The explanations for the uses of prepositions (da, di, a and per) are extremely skimpy and leave out important differences in function. There are many other deficiencies in the book. Result: I have ordered two other grammar texts, in the hope of getting something decent.
